makefile.incl.linux
来自「Oracle OCI的C++类的一个封装」· LINUX 代码 · 共 46 行
LINUX
46 行
#################################################################
###
### Prodigy Makefile.incl for LINUX
###
### 1. values for some macros:
###
### PLATFORM: SUN,HP,IBM,COMPAQ,WIN32
### DATABASE: INFORMIX, ORACLE
##################################################################
PLATFORM = LINUX
DATABASE = ORACLE
SRCHOME = /ztesoft/prodigy/src
CCC = g++
PFLAGS = -D_POSIX_PTHREAD_SEMANTICS -D_REENTRANT
PLDFLAGS =
LONGSIZE = LONG64
BASEFLAGS = -D$(LONGSIZE) -DNO_DEBUG_NEW
CCFLAGS = -g -D$(COMPILER) $(BASEFLAGS) -DOS_$(PLATFORM) -D_$(PLATFORM) -D_$(DATABASE) $($(PLATFORM)FLAGS) -DDB_$(DATABASE)
AR = ar -rv
PLIBS = -lpthread
.SUFFIXES: .cpp .o .exe
LIBS = $(LOCALLIB) $($(DATABASE)LIBS) $($(PLATFORM)LIBS)
.cpp.o:
$(CCC) -c $(CCFLAGS) -c $< -o $*.o $(LOCALINC)
.o.exe:
$(CCC) $(LLDFLAGS) -o $* $< $(LIBS)
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?